SKYLINE GARDENS, INC., v. McGARRY


22 N.J. Super. 193 (1952)

91 A.2d 621

SKYLINE GARDENS, INC., PLAINTIFF-APPELLANT, v. EVERETT J. McGARRY, DEFENDANT-RESPONDENT.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Appellate Division.

Decided October 17, 1952.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mr. Paul N. Belmont argued the cause for the appellant (Mr. George I. Marcus, attorney; Mr. Walter D. Van Riper on the brief).

Mr. Hyman W. Rosenthal argued the cause for the respondent (Mr. Milton Schleider, attorney).

Before Judges FREUND, STANTON and CONLON.


The opinion of the court was delivered by CONLON, J.C.C. (temporarily assigned).

The plaintiff, owner of an apartment house in North Arlington, New Jersey, brought this action in the Bergen County District Court for the recovery of rent in the amount of $36.
